HMSTG437 (Dobashi 5901 and others) is the dark nebula at the bottom right.

HMSTG472 is the dark nebula at the bottom center.

HMSTG483 (Sandqvist 158 and others) is the large dark nebula at the center.

HMSTG498 (Sandqvist 160 and others) is the small cloud to the left of center.

There are actually 19 designated HMSTG objects in this field. See the annotated image.

More information on HMSTG catalog of “southern dark clouds” can be found here - https://articles.adsabs.harvard.edu/pdf ... ..63...27H.

Luminance – 13x600s – 130 minutes – binned 1x1
RGB – 13x600s – 130 minutes each – binned 1x1

520 minutes total exposure – 8 hour 40 minutes

Imaged April 23rd, 24th, 28th, 30th and May 1st, 2022 at the Heaven’s Mirror Observatory (Australia) with a FLI PL16083 on a Takahashi FSQ-106ED at f/3.6 382 mm.
